Sew Thankful

Hi guys,  how's this for a really sweet and quick sewing card?  The background was embossed with the So Trendy embossibility folder.  I cut a border using the new edgeability insert with the scalloped cutting edge.  I dyed some white American seam binding using tumbled glass and crushed olive distress inks.  I did this twice to get the colour a bit darker.  You need to dry it completely then use more ink swiped on to your craft mat and spritzed with water.  I wanted a shabby chic look to the ribbon and bow so I scrunched it as I dried it to achieve this.  I cut a dressform and a pin cushion and a sewing machine using the  Nina Brackett sewing element dies.  I inked through the die to bring out the details on the dressform and the pin cushion.  The sewing machine was the leftover piece from another card I made where I used the negative piece.  I stamped my sentiment on a tag and inked the edges.  I attached a button with some Bakers Twine to it and added it to my bow.  I added some pearly swirlies and paper pierced the edge to complete the card.  Are these dies growing on you too?  All for now, Sue x
